05/11/2006 | W H Malcolm saTISSfied with anti-siphon

Sales of TISS’ anti-siphon devices show no signs of abating after W H Malcolm announced they were fitting their entire fleet of vehicles with TISS’ “Standard” anti-siphon device.

W H Malcolm’s Fleet Engineer, Steve Sugden, made the decision to fit the entire fleet after he assessed four competing anti-siphons and subsequently selected the TISS system.

Mr Sugden commented: ‘After evaluating a number of devices, I found that the TISS unit was the best engineered anti-siphon on the market.  Since purchasing the systems I have found them to be easy to fit and highly effective in preventing fuel theft’.

TISS now supply their anti-siphons to most of the top companies that featured in the Motor Transport’s Top 100.  Other companies that fit TISS anti-siphons include Exel, Wincanton, Christian Salvesen, NYK Logistics and Gist.

Launched earlier this year, sales of TISS’ “Standard” anti-siphon have surpassed the 2,000 units in less than six months.  With a neck measuring just 2 inches long, it is the shortest anti-siphon device on the market so it is the most effective in preventing fuel theft. It can be fitted in less than one minute and costs just £64, which makes it an attractive fuel theft deterrent for HGV operators.

TISS Sales Director, Ryan Wholey, was pleased with the announcement: ‘W H Malcolm’s decision to equip their fleet with our Standard anti-siphon illustrates the extent of fuel siphoning in the UK.  In addition, they have given our anti-siphon a massive endorsement by selecting it ahead of other credible units’.

 

(As published in Roadway Magazine, November 2006).
